ADC 12 aluminium ingot prices in China rise on reduced production, increased costs

April 30, 2021 / www.metalbulletin.com / Article Link

ADC 12 aluminium alloy prices in China rose on Wednesday April 28, due to higher production costs and reduced supplies, caused by a month of environmental inspections in Jiangxi province.

China's Environmental Protection Inspection Team is conducting checks in Jiangxi until May 7 and many ADC 12 producers there have lowered their output while the checks take place.
"We heard that producers in Jiangxi were not running at full capacity; some were running at half of their total capacity, while others only at one third," a producer source said.
